How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 27529?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 27529 Studio Apartments | $1,187 | $1,000 | $1,285 |
| 27529 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,423 | $651 | $2,278 |
| 27529 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,677 | $780 | $2,683 |
| 27529 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,883 | $898 | $3,191 |
| 27529 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,400 | $2,400 | $2,400 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 27529 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 27529?
There are currently 20 Studio Apartments in 27529 with rent ranges from $1,000 to $1,285 with an average price of $1,187.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 27529 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 27529 ranges from $651 to $2,278 with an average monthly rent of $1,423.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 27529 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 27529 range from $780 to $2,683.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,677.
How expensive are 27529 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 32 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 27529 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$898 to $3,191 - averaging $1,883 for the location.
